Los Angeles Hair Transplant Surgeon Schedules San Francisco Stop for 2019 Hair Restoration Seminar Series
SAN FRANCISCO, May 30, 2019 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- Dr. Parsa Mohebi, the founder of Parsa Mohebi Hair Restoration with locations in Los Angeles, Beverly Hills and San Francisco, has been traveling across the country conducting a series of hair restoration seminars to help patients better understand the life changing benefits of hair transplant surgery. The next stop on his 2019 seminar series schedule is San Francisco on June 22nd.

In order to add a local element to each stop on the seminar series, Dr. Mohebi invites a local board-certified hair restoration surgeon to take part in the event. According to Dr. Mohebi, "the local surgeons take part in a roundtable discussion and we give a complete overview of the hair restoration process. It is enjoyable to have a local surgeon at each seminar stop because it puts the local patients at ease to chat with a doctor from their city. Our roundtable discussion includes a chat about the entire hair restoration process. We walk the participants through each step and that includes starting with the consultation process. We also discuss the actual procedure as well as the recovery period and the amount of time it will take before patients see the final results."
